BarryG 10-07-2004, 08:48 PM For the 5 weeks of the series, you keep 4 of the 5 weeks points. You get 100 for 1st, 99 for 2nd etc. TQ gets 1 bonus pt. 404 pts, would be a perfect score. So basically if you didn't attend at least 4 of the 5 weeks, you stand no chance for winning that class.
